The J, formerly known as The JCC is hosting a pool party celebrating summer AND Yom Ha’atzmaut on Sunday, May 28, from 11 a.m.-2 p.m. The Free Family Festival & Yom Ha’atzmaut Celebration will feature Israel-inspired arts and craft activities, carnival games, bouncy house, food and more in The J’s Family Park and Poolside!
“Nothing brings people together like a free afternoon at the pool with loads of activities to engage the whole family,” said Lenae Price, The J Philanthropy & Outreach Director.
Yom Ha’atzmaut, Israeli Independence Day, is a celebration in Israel marked with family picnics and hikes, public shows put on by cities or visits to Army camps which are open to the public on that day. While Yom Ha’atzmaut fell on May 1st this year, The J is moving the party to coincide with the opening of the outdoor pools.
